Transaction d86bf77acd13cea895ca100cca836a8d2ca974ba70b35b5d586f7ace1e1e40fd
1 Input
1 Output
-
d86bf77acd13cea895ca100cca836a8d2ca974ba70b35b5d586f7ace1e1e40fd:0
- value
- 1577457
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b53adb5f952666763241a4bf4ba0499228ee1cd OP_EQUAL
- address
- 3P9JxiFYZgCcFZ3kEN16NAs4woPh6oY5zB